CVE-2019-11565
Server Side Request Forgery (SSRF) exists in the Print My Blog plugin prior to 1.6.7 for WordPress via the site parameter.

CVE-2021-24636
The Print My Blog WordPress Plugin prior to 3.4.2 does not enforce nonce (CSRF) checks, which allows malicious users to make logged in administrators deactivate the Print My Blog plugin and delete all saved data for that plugin by tricking them to open a malicious link
